Overview
System type: Antifreeze, evacuated-tube solar hot water
Location: Springfield, Missouri
Solar resource: 5 average daily peak sun-hours
Annual production: 8 million Btu
Percentage of DHW produced annually: 60% to 70%
Equipment
Collector: 30-tube, Apricus
Collector installation: Roof-mounted, oriented to true south, tilted at latitude (37°)
Heat transfer fluid: Rhomar HD propylene glycol
Circulation pump: Caleffi solar pump station model 255060, with integrated Wilo Star 16
Pump controller: Watts Solar
Storage
Tanks: Heat Transfer Products, SSU-80, 80 gal., dual-coil
Heat exchanger: Integrated in tank
Backup DHW: Electro Industries, 6 kW wall-hung boiler for the radiant heating system; 40-gal. electric tank for DHW; The Superstor tank preheats the DHW and supplies radiant from the upper coil.
System Performance Metering
Thermometer: Watts Solar Controller with heat-metering function and data logging
Flow meter: Integrated with Caleffi solar pump station
Pressure: Integrated with the Caleffi solar pump station
